Position Summary:
The Purchasing Clerk plays an integral role in supporting the hotel's daily operations, with a strong focus on Food & Beverage procurement and inventory management. This position is responsible for sourcing quality products, maintaining appropriate inventory levels, and ensuring the accurate and efficient receiving and distribution of all hotel deliveries. As a key partner to the culinary and operations teams, this role helps drive consistency, cost control, and overall operational excellence.
What You'll Do:
- Coordinate the purchasing of food, beverage, and operating supplies in alignment with hotel standards and budget expectations
- Build and maintain strong relationships with approved vendors to ensure quality products and timely deliveries
- Monitor inventory levels across all Food & Beverage outlets, proactively managing reorders and minimizing waste
- Review and reconcile invoices against purchase orders to ensure accuracy and identify discrepancies
- Support cost control initiatives by tracking pricing trends and identifying savings opportunities
- Receive and inspect all incoming shipments, verifying product quality, quantities, and overall condition
- Accurately log, organize, and distribute deliveries to the appropriate departments promptly
- Maintain clean, organized, and compliant storage areas, including dry goods, refrigerated, and beverage storage
- Manage all incoming and outgoing packages for the hotel, including guest deliveries and interdepartmental shipments
- Maintain accurate purchasing and receiving records, including invoices, packing slips, and inventory logs
- Assist with routine inventory counts and audits for Food & Beverage operations
- Partner with department leaders to communicate order updates, substitutions, and product availability
- Ensure adherence to food safety standards, company policies, and operational procedures
